Light Color Choice



Selecting light colors for your painting can substantially boost the illusion of area within your art work. Light shades such as soft pastels, whites, and light grays have the ability to show more light, making a space really feel more open and airy. These shades develop a sense of expansiveness, making wall surfaces show up to recede and ceilings appear greater.

By utilizing light colors on both walls and ceilings, you can blur the borders of the area, providing the impression of a larger location.

Strategic Trim Paint



When intending to develop the illusion of area in your paint, tactical trim painting plays an important duty in defining limits and boosting deepness understanding. By tactically picking the shades and finishes for trim work, you can effectively manipulate just how light connects with the room, ultimately influencing exactly how large or tiny a room feels.

On the other hand, repainting the trim the same shade as the wall surfaces can produce a seamless appearance that obscures the edges, providing the impression of a constant surface area and making the limits of the area less specified.

In addition, making use of a high-gloss surface on trim can mirror much more light, additional improving the perception of space. Alternatively, a matte surface can soak up light, creating a cozier ambience.

Thoroughly considering these details when painting trim can dramatically affect the overall feel and perceived size of a room.

Optical Illusion Techniques



Using visual fallacy techniques in paint can properly change assumptions of deepness and room within a provided setting. One typical technique is making use of gradients, where colors change from light to dark tones. By applying a lighter shade at the top of a wall surface and gradually dimming it in the direction of the bottom, the ceiling can appear greater, developing a feeling of vertical room. Alternatively, painting the flooring a darker color than the walls can make it seem like the room prolongs additionally than it really does.

An additional visual fallacy method includes the calculated positioning of patterns. Horizontal stripes, for example, can visually expand a narrow area, while upright stripes can elongate a space. Geometric patterns or murals with viewpoint can additionally deceive the eye right into perceiving even more depth.
